Biscotti di Prato, also called cantucci, are twice-baked almond biscuits traditionally served with Vin Santo. They are Prato's signature sweet and a classic local gift.
Mortadella di Prato is a historic local cold cut seasoned with spices and alchermes. Its distinctive aroma makes it one of the city's best-known traditional foods.
Sedani alla pratese is pasta with a slow-cooked meat ragù, often enriched with tomato and local flavors. It is a beloved Sunday-style dish in Prato homes.
